FrostyDesign
自分用にさまざまなものを作るページです
新型コントローラ
- 2012/09/15 (Sat)
- 未選択 |
- CM(2) |
- Edit |
- ▲Top
というわけで、プリント基板化+FPGA更新して新型になりました。
なんか名前があったほうが良いかなということで
FrostyDesign謹製 FrostyCore1.0とかにしましょう。(今までのは0.9?)
既出も含めてスペック説明。
CPU SH7145 32bit 50MHz memory1MB Flash2MB
besttechnorogy BTC080 SH7145Fマイコンボード
FPGA SPARTAN-6 XC6SLX45-2CSG324C
HUMANDATA XP68-03 PLCC 68PIN Spartan-6 FPGA モジュール
インターフェース仕様
近藤科学シリアルサーボ通信仕様 ICS3.5 115kbps 6ch
プレイステーション2コントローラIF(動作確認はlogicoolコントローラのみ。正規の通信仕様より送受信間隔詰めて使用)
AD 6ch(ジャイロ×2ch(5V)、ジャイロ×1ch(3.3V)、加速度センサー3軸(3.3V)
幅57mm奥行49mm高さ23mm(足を含めると26mm)
重さ44.3g(CPU基板15.7g、IF基板25.1g、FPGA基板3.5g)
ケーブル、スイッチ、コネクタ、足とかいろいろ込み込みだと72.5g
写真
CPU基板
CPU側のクロックに同期してFPGAを動かすため、クロックラインを引き出してます。
IF基板(今回プリント基板を起こしました)
FPGA基板
FPGAは外部に引き出したJTAG端子からダウンロードケーブルを使って書き込みます。
部品リスト
面倒なのでexcelファイルです。
ダウンロード(xls)
関連過去投稿
アーキテクチャ
http://frostyorange.blog.shinobi.jp/Entry/19/
ユニバーサル基板で作ったときの紹介
http://frostyorange.blog.shinobi.jp/Entry/17/
kicad
http://frostyorange.blog.shinobi.jp/Entry/21/
基板発注
http://frostyorange.blog.shinobi.jp/Entry/22/
今回作成したプリント基板は5枚作成しましたので
欲しい方がいれば実費程度にて配布します。
中古、ストックその他でCPUボードを入手可能な方のみ提供します。
(2013/1/18時点で在庫復活しています。)
サポートはものぐさなので、それなりです。
ストックせずに使う意思のあるかた、
情報公開して有志を増やせそうな方を優先します。
提供範囲
プリント基板
kicadデータ(自分が分かればOKレベルなので状況にあわせて相談します。)
FPGAのソースコード+バイナリ(verilogです。)
動作確認用のサンプルソフト(基本的にはデバイスの動作確認レベルを想定)
部品リスト
PR
カレンダー
カテゴリー
プロフィール
最新記事
(06/29)
(05/12)
(05/02)
(02/21)
(07/08)
最新CM
[06/28 Braitaereks]
[08/29 l8xc6xc236]
[06/29 MichaelGek]
[06/18 Michaelted]
[06/14 GeorgeaccoG]
この記事へのコメント
見つけました
参加表明
7145愛用していて凄く欲しいですが、クロックライン引き出す加工に自信がなかったり。
そこで、全ピン引き出されてる秋月の7144でも使えないかテストしてみたいと思います。
cpuとfpgaの通信のバス幅次第では全くかもしれませんが。
Re:参加表明
参加表明ありがとうございます。
確認事項等ありますので、メールアドレスをお知らせください。
非公開コメントで書き込んでいただければ連絡します。